Shortlist: Eight Restaurants In Calera (AL) That Locals Love!

Calera, located 30 miles south of Birmingham along I-65, is one of the major chemical lime manufacturing sites in the United States. The once-named “Lime Kiln Station” now has roughly 13,800 inhabitants, and a surprisingly good food scene.

The residents of this bustling city are lucky to have a great variety of unique restaurants and culinary experiences. Far from being a quaint town with limited choices, Calera has a whole array of food options to choose from, like Asian restaurants, BBQ places, wineries, and more.

3. Milo’s Hamburgers

Best burger place in town according to many locals, family owned and operated, with exquisite dessert options too.

Milo’s Hamburger is the brainchild of Milo Carlton. A self-taught chef who refined his burger skills as a mess cook in the United States Army before opening his first burger establishment in 1946. With a secret sauce that’s still in use today, he believed that the value of hard work, and providing people something extra while listening to their feedback, were the keys to a successful business.

Milo’s Hamburgers has been doing something right that’s for sure, as it has become a true icon of the town, making it one of the most popular restaurants in Calera.

With numerous burgers and sandwich options to choose from, there’s something for everyone at Milo’s. Whether you’re craving meat or want some chicken tenders, the place has it all. Just make sure to order some extra servings of Milo’s original sauce to add an additional level of deliciousness to your meal. Top the evening off with their fried pies and you’ll be in seventh heaven.

With a simple, diner-like décor, Milo’s is a great place to just relax and enjoy the food. The eatery is often where many locals can be found, taking in one of the best burgers the town has to offer. The staff is polite and efficient too, so if you’re unsure of what to order, they can definitely step in to help.

Enjoy a great meal at Milos any day of the week, because the restaurant is open from 10:30 am to 9 pm every day. Making it a great spot to go to when you don’t want to worry about closing and opening times.

Address: 1 Limestone Parkway, Calera, AL.
